WebMethods The two routine triglycerides methods were the fluorometric method of Kessler and Lederer and the enzymatic method. The methods were standardized using 495 … WebMar 1, 1971 · Method To 100 ;ul of serum in a 15-ml centrifuge tube, fitted with a ground glass stopper, add 4 ml of l N HaSOand 4 ml of chloroform. Stopper tightly and shake on the shaking machine for 10 minutes. Centrifuge and aspirate the aqueous top layer and the protein button (middle layer).

WebSep 21, 2015 · Fluorometric assays are a little more sensitive than colorimetric assays and they are able to detect more of an analyte than colorimetric assays. They allow for a very high reading to be measured by widening the dynamic range.
